Danielle Ruhl is getting ready to sing a different note!

After news broke pertaining to the "Love Is Blind" star's decision to file for divorce from her husband Nick Thompson, whom she met and fell in love with on the Netflix reality show, last month, Ruhl has been extremely transparent about the effect of divorce has had on her mental health.

The 29-year-old has devoted a lot of her social media activity to showcasing how she has really felt while dealing with a massive heartbreak in the public eye.

Ruhl's decision to reveal the extremely personal component of her life has not been a recent one. She has openly discussed her experiences with mental health both past and present, especially since rising to fame earlier this winter as a "Love Is Blind" cast member.

What Are Some Highlights Pertaining To Ruhl's Mental Health Experience?

The Blast has frequently kept up with Ruhl's transparent mental health discussions on her social media, primarily on Instagram.

Despite making the courageous decision to openly discuss her feelings and the many instances of positive feedback she's received from fans, her decision hasn't been met without criticism.

In an article from February shortly after season two debuted on Netflix, we followed Ruhl's honest Instagram post where she responded to critics and attempted to provide some clarity regarding a panic attack she had on the show; Thompson struggled with responding to Ruhl's needs in a productive way.

"One thing that is being inaccurately speculated about is the panic attack I had in Mexico," she wrote in the post and elaborated that she had recalled a traumatic experience to Thompson to the best of her ability in the moment.

Ruhl then gave further insight into the inspiration for the panic attack.

"While I was lying there sick, I started to get in my own head and wondered whether I had shared too much too soon, and I started to relive an event that I had repressed for so long. This caused me to have a panic attack and I went into the closet so that no one could see me in such a public environment," she wrote.

Writing Her Way To Healing: How Ruhl Incorporates Journaling Into Her Mental Health Journey

Earlier this afternoon, Ruhl provided her Instagram followers with a glimpse into a previously publicly unseen side to her mental health journey; she vulnerably not only revealed that she frequently relies on the practice of keeping a journal, but she has also been dabbing in songwriting for a long time!

"I have connected with so many of you who relate to my story and experiences while riding the mental health wave," she wrote in the caption of her Instagram post, "I previously shared lyrics and a voice note I wrote when I was 15 regarding giving up and why it shouldn't be an option. It is something I often re-listen to when I am experiencing extreme emotions."

Ruhl went on to reveal, "Because of this, I have decided to share some of the excerpts of my journal. I will be releasing three songs that are in relation to my past and current mental health struggles that I wrote from the ages of 15-29. I will be releasing 'The Way Down' first, as a lot of you messaged me that you relate to the lyrics..."

A snippet of "The Way Down" can be heard in the second slide of Ruhl's post! Her sharing of the vulnerable lyrics will be an ongoing process for the reality star.

She also revealed that fans will hear the full version of the song later this week, and will go on to share "A few more throughout the month!"
